@felipigu 

I don't know why your camera would simply disappear entirely from the Google Nest app.

But if you are attempting to reinstall your camera in the Google Nest app and are getting a message saying your camera is connected to another account, that probably means your camera is still connected to YOUR account, and cannot be reinstalled unless you do a "factory reset".

Unfortunately, as noted in the Help topic below, the only way to "factory reset" a 1st gen Google Nest Indoor Camera is to remove it from the Google Nest app, but you're reporting that it has disappeared from the Google Nest app.
